Read binary files in the Igor Binary Wave format (IBW)

read.ibw(wavefile, Verbose = FALSE, ReturnTimeSeries = FALSE,
  MakeWave = FALSE, HeaderOnly = FALSE)

Arguments

wavefile

either a character vector containing the path to a file or an R connection.

Verbose

if TRUE, print status information while reading the file.

ReturnTimeSeries

if TRUE, return as an R time series (package ts).

MakeWave

if TRUE, assign wave to a list in the global user environment.

HeaderOnly

if TRUE, only return the header of the Igor Wave.

Value

A vector containing the wave data or, if MakeWave == TRUE, returns the name of a new R vector containing the data which has been made in the user environment

Examples

# return a list containing the wave wavedata=read.ibw(system.file("igor","version5.ibw",package="IgorR")) sum(wavedata)
#> [1] 15
# make a list containing the wave's data in the users's environment wavename=read.ibw(system.file("igor","version5.ibw",package="IgorR"),MakeWave=TRUE) sum(get(wavename))
#> [1] 15
